Teaching the value of money

Ahren happily sorting his money for deposit to the bank

Ahren's school has a savings program to help them learn the value of money. Instead of just putting money into his bank account (they opened a bank account specifically for the program), We thought it would do him good if he really learns how to do it (the hard way). For months, Ahren would collect coins we occasionally give him and put it in his angry bird coin bank.When it was full already, we had him help sort the coins. I showed him how I inventoried the coins and wrote on the bank form.

He wrote his own name on the signatory portion. Then he trooped to the bank to deposit his money. Ahren believes he will be rich someday if he continues to deposit his money to the bank (When the time comes, I will show him how to invest his money).
